What a logitech mx keys s angled tray is

A 6 degree tray that parks an MX Keys S (about 440 × 130 × 20 mm) so the front edge matches an MX Master. The well is 442 × 132 mm with 0.4 mm clearance, a 14 mm USB-C slot at the back, and the plate is 450 × 145 × 22 mm. Print as two PLA halves with 1.6 mm walls.
